A researcher is preparing to insert a human gene of interest into a bacterial plasmid in order to clone the human gene. She has genetically engineered the plasmid to carry a gene amp R , which confers resistance to the antibiotic ampicillin. She will include ampicillin in the plating medium when she grows the recombinant bacteria. Why has she engineered the plasmid to include an antibiotic resistance gene? Choose the best answer. The figure shows a bacterial plasmid which has an amp superscript R gene, the gene for ampicillin resistance, and a lacZ gene, the gene for lactose breakdown. The lacZ gene has a restriction site. Recombinant bacteria that have taken up the plasmid can be recognized because they are able to survive in the presence of ampicillin.
